چگونه میتوان با استفاده از تنها چند پایه از میکروکنترلر، تعداد زیادی پورت ورودی/خروجی ساخت؟ چگونه در میکروکنترلرهایی که محدودیت تعداد پایه وجود دارد، میتوان از پورتهای بیشتری استفاده کرد؟
ادامه مطلب
الکترونیک
آموزش پیاده سازی کنترل کننده منطق فازی Fuzzy Logic Controller بر روی میکروکنترلر
مقدمه
همانطور که میدانید، کنترلکنندههای مختلفی در علم مهندسی کنترل ارایه شدهاست. هر کدام از این کنترلکنندهها بسته به نوع کنترل و نیازمندیهای سیستم کنترل، مورد استفاده قرار میگیرند. یکی از بهترین و رایجترین روشهای کنترلی، الگوریتم…
پروژه مدار ماشین حساب ساده چهار عمل اصلی ریاضی با آردوینو Arduino و LCD کاراکتری
مقدمه
یک ماشینحساب ساده، ماشینحسابی است که تنها چهار عمل اصلی محاسبات ریاضی را در خود شامل شدهاست. این چهار عمل اصلی بهترتیب اولویت عبارتند از: تقسیم، ضرب، تفریق و جمع. یک ماشینحساب ساده، میتواند عملیات ریاضی را تنها بر روی دو مقدار…
پروژه ساعت، دماسنج و تقویم میلادی، شمسی و قمری دیجیتال با سون سگمنت ۷Segments به زبان سی C
مقدمه
پیادهسازی یک ساعت یا تقویم که از دقت بسیار بالایی برخوردار بوده و علاوه بر آن بتواند تاریخهای مختلفی را در خود شامل شود، کار سادهای نخواهد بود. در این پروژه، تمامی این امکانات مهیا شدهاست. ساختار این ساعت به گونهای است که طبق…
پروژه آموزشی ساعت دیجیتالی شش رقمی ساده با ۷ Segment به زبان کدویژن CodeVision AVR C
مقدمه
این پروژه آموزشی، در واقع یک ساعت دیجیتال شش رقمی با میکروکنترلرهای AVR به زبان سی C می باشد و توسط کاربر گرامی "آذین داودی" ارسال و در سایت قرار گرفته شده است.